什么是WordPress圖床圖片本地化
WordPress圖床圖片本地化是指將原本存儲(chǔ)在第三方圖床服務(wù)上的圖片資源遷移到網(wǎng)站自己的服務(wù)器或存儲(chǔ)空間中的過(guò)程。許多WordPress用戶最初會(huì)使用圖床服務(wù)來(lái)托管圖片,以減輕服務(wù)器負(fù)擔(dān)和節(jié)省帶寬。但隨著網(wǎng)站發(fā)展,將圖片本地化往往能帶來(lái)更好的性能表現(xiàn)和管理便利。
為什么要進(jìn)行圖片本地化
提升加載速度:第三方圖床服務(wù)器可能位于海外或響應(yīng)緩慢,本地化后圖片與網(wǎng)站同服務(wù)器,加載更快
增強(qiáng)穩(wěn)定性:避免因圖床服務(wù)故障或關(guān)閉導(dǎo)致圖片無(wú)法顯示的風(fēng)險(xiǎn)
SEO優(yōu)化:本地圖片更易被搜索引擎抓取和索引,有利于網(wǎng)站排名
管理便捷:所有媒體文件集中管理,無(wú)需在多平臺(tái)間切換
數(shù)據(jù)安全:完全掌控自己的網(wǎng)站資源,避免第三方服務(wù)條款變更帶來(lái)的影響
圖片本地化的實(shí)現(xiàn)方法
1. 手動(dòng)下載并重新上傳
最基礎(chǔ)的方法是手動(dòng)從圖床下載所有圖片,然后通過(guò)WordPress媒體庫(kù)重新上傳。這種方法適合圖片數(shù)量較少的情況,但效率低下且容易出錯(cuò)。
2. 使用插件自動(dòng)化遷移
推薦使用專業(yè)插件完成遷移:
- Auto Upload Images:自動(dòng)將外部圖片下載到本地媒體庫(kù)
- Import External Images:批量處理現(xiàn)有內(nèi)容中的外部圖片
- Cloudinary:高級(jí)解決方案,可同時(shí)管理本地和云端圖片
3. 數(shù)據(jù)庫(kù)批量替換
對(duì)于技術(shù)人員,可以通過(guò)SQL命令或WP-CLI批量替換文章中的圖片鏈接,但操作風(fēng)險(xiǎn)較高,建議先備份數(shù)據(jù)庫(kù)。
本地化后的優(yōu)化建議
- 圖片壓縮:使用Smush、ShortPixel等插件優(yōu)化圖片大小
- CDN加速:雖圖片本地化,仍可配合CDN進(jìn)一步提升全球訪問(wèn)速度
- 懶加載:實(shí)現(xiàn)圖片延遲加載,改善用戶體驗(yàn)
- 定期備份:本地化后圖片成為網(wǎng)站重要資產(chǎn),需納入常規(guī)備份計(jì)劃
常見(jiàn)問(wèn)題與解決方案
Q:本地化會(huì)占用大量服務(wù)器空間怎么辦? A:可考慮升級(jí)主機(jī)方案,或使用對(duì)象存儲(chǔ)服務(wù)如阿里云OSS、AWS S3等
Q:遷移后原圖床鏈接如何處理? A:設(shè)置301重定向,或?qū)⑴f鏈接批量替換為新鏈接,避免死鏈
Q:本地化過(guò)程中出現(xiàn)圖片丟失怎么辦? A:務(wù)必提前備份網(wǎng)站,可考慮分批次遷移測(cè)試
WordPress圖床圖片本地化是網(wǎng)站發(fā)展到一定階段后的必要優(yōu)化步驟,不僅能提升訪問(wèn)速度,還能增強(qiáng)網(wǎng)站的安全性和可控性。根據(jù)網(wǎng)站規(guī)模和需求選擇合適的遷移方案,配合后續(xù)優(yōu)化措施,將使您的WordPress網(wǎng)站性能得到顯著提升。